    Corner Brook’s annual Jigs and Wheels festival is slightly more than one week away. This year’s  Opening Concert, otherwise known as Blame it on Broadway, is a closed street festival with a massive outdoor stage and rocking bands all night long. On Bayfm with Lenny Benoit, Mayor Jim Parsons says this event is always a hit for all ages. Performers include the Jason Rogers Band, Midnight Crescent, Randy Matthews and Co., Roblo’s Rock, and The Mixed Tapes. Parsons says the music will go form 6 until 2 a.m. There will also be great prices provided by Corner Brook West Sports Club.
